Baraka College Student Plots and Beekeeping Programme
During his recent visit to Baraka Agricultural College in western Kenya, Gortas Country Representative for Kenya, William Keyah, had the opportunity to view the demonstration plots maintained by each student enrolled on an agricultural programme at the College. William also reviewed the innovative Beekeeping Development Programme aimed at empowering rural communities to engage in beekeeping as an alternative, environmentally friendly enterprise for improved and secure livelihoods.
Natural Beekeeping
Top Bar Hive Beekeeping in Oklahoma. Bees building natural sized comb as they see fit. Not dictated by imprinted foundation. They draw this out very fast with light sugar syrup stimulation in the early spring.

Oakhurst Community Garden – Beekeeping in the Garden
The Oakhurst Community Garden Project teaches environmental awareness to diverse local students through hands-on gardening and outdoor education programs. They are dedicated to empowering young people to become the next generation of environmental stewards by engaging in projects that address real needs.Bee’s are becoming more and more scarce in our communities and around the world. Guillotine Pictures stepped in and talked to the bee keepers at the Oakhurst Community Garden to help create this video to show people how easy it is to help with this increasing problem.
